    Trauma Sensitive Practice - Working with Complex Trauma

    Online
    1 day, Wed 9:30 AM AEST - Wed 5:00 PM AEST
    This training blends foundational knowledge of complex trauma with an introduction to the practice of safety and stabilisation. Drawing on current research, the session explores the impacts of trauma and the neurobiological responses that can occur when individuals experience traumatic stress. Participants will develop an understanding of the key features of complex trauma and how these may present within therapeutic and professional relationships.

    Exploring Moral Distress and the Importance of Caring for Ourselves

    Online
    1 hour, 30 minutes, Wed 12:00 PM AEST - Wed 1:30 PM AEST
    This webinar explores the importance of caring for ourselves while supporting others in trauma-exposed and helping roles. Participants will examine the impacts that caring work can have on wellbeing, including experiences of moral distress, and consider how these challenges can affect sustainability in the work. The session introduces approaches that support self-awareness, wellbeing and professional sustainability, helping participants recognise the importance of caring for themselves.

    Trauma Responsive Leadership - Organisational Practice

    Online
    1 day, Fri 9:30 AM AEST - Fri 5:00 PM AEST
    This program builds on the Secure Base Leadership framework introduced in the first session and takes a broader organisational lens to explore what it means to foster a trauma-informed culture. Participants will reflect on how leadership influences the creation of trauma-sensitive environments that support both clients and staff. The session explores the domains of a trauma-informed organisation and considers the elements required to create environments that support safety, connection and wellbeing.

    Managing Wellbeing and Recognising Vicarious Trauma

    Online
    1 day, Fri 9:30 AM AEST - Fri 5:00 PM AEST
    This training explores the nature, dynamics and risks of vicarious trauma and supports practitioners to sustain their wellbeing while working with people impacted by trauma. Drawing on current research, participants will develop a deeper understanding of the early signs and impacts of stress responses that can arise in trauma-exposed work. The session introduces practical strategies across organisational, interpersonal and personal levels to help address the risks associated with vicarious trauma.

    Using a Trauma Lens when working with Domestic and Family Violence

    Online
    1 day, Wed 9:30 AM AEST - Wed 5:00 PM AEST
    This training provides trauma-informed knowledge and practical skills for professionals working with individuals and families who have experienced domestic and family violence (DFV). Participants will develop a deeper understanding of complex trauma and how experiences of DFV can impact wellbeing, behaviour and relationships.
